The function of a language can be divided into following categories:
Context
Addressee
contact
common code message
A message is sent by addresser (sender ) to the addressee (receiver).The message can not be understood outside of a context. A code should be common fully or at least partially to the addresser and addressee.A contact which is physical channel and phsychological connection between addresser and addressee is necessary for both of them to enter and stay in connection.

One of the main goals of language teachers is to provide students with the tools

to be effective communicators in the TL. Often when students are assigned

projects and assignments (like the weather report in Anna’s case study) their

lack of practical tools to produce the actual language becomes evident. In these

cases, students might very well have the necessary resources to accomplish the

task, but teachers might need to consider a communicative approach to teaching

the language, focusing on the functions of language, to properly equip students

to complete assigned tasks. In this section we will explore functions of
language and how they can be taught in the SL classroom
